By tan and white do you mean chestnut or palomino or buckskin and white skewbald??? You would most likely have a 25% chance of a skewbald. A huge variety of of base colour combinations that you could get. You'd have to know what colour the stallion was born and what colour the mare is. And as Stallion is grey theres a good chance that it doesn't matter what colour foal is when it hits the ground it may grey out. Also helps to knw grandparents colours.
